When it comes to classic Mexican side dishes, you can't go wrong with a flavorful and satisfying tomato rice. This dish, also known as Arroz Rojo or Spanish Rice, is a staple in Mexican cuisine and is often served alongside a variety of main dishes such as tacos, fajitas, and enchiladas. Its rich, bold flavor and vibrant color make it a standout addition to any Mexican-inspired meal.
What makes this Mexican tomato rice recipe so special is its perfect balance of savory and tangy flavors, thanks to the combination of ripe tomatoes, aromatic onion and garlic, and a blend of spices and herbs. The rice is cooked in a tomato-based broth, ensuring that each grain is infused with the delicious flavors of the sauce.
